      Once a citation has been made, you must cite the same source within the same paragraph with the author and year again. If there are 2 authors, always cite both. If there are 3, 4, or 5 authors, cite all authors the first time, then with subsequent authors cite only the first author followed by et al., year Example: Smith et al., 2004

      If the use of et al. may lead to confusion between two groups of authors, e.g. Hunt, Hartley, and Davies (1993) and Hunt, Davies, and Baker (1993), then cite all three authors at every mention (or, for more than three authors, cite as many as are needed to differentiate between the two references).
